Compensation/Reward Manager overseeing key reward processes during key financial cycles for digital entertainment group in Cape Town. Responsible for compensation operations, analytics, and team collaboration.
Responsibilities
**Purpose of this role**:
This role provides hands-on compensation leadership during a critical period in our annual people and financial cycles. The Compensation / Reward Manager will oversee key reward processes, support the implementation of our new compensation strategy, ensure accurate staff cost management, and partner closely with Finance, People Partners, and business leaders.
The role includes responsibility for compensation operations, analytics, benchmarking, and annual cycle delivery. It will also manage a Senior Systems & Data Analyst; however, this is a highly independent role. This is an **8-month fixed term** role, based in Cape Town.
**Key responsibilities / accountabilities:**
__Annual Compensation Cycles__
Lead the execution of the annual Pay Review and Bonus cycles. *(Prep will begin pre-contract)*
Partner with Finance and People Partners to ensure cycle readiness, communication, and timely execution.
Oversee multi-sheet workbooks, ensuring accurate analysis, scenario modelling and data reconciliation across spreadsheets.
__Compensation Strategy Implementation__
Support execution of the new compensation strategy, including refining frameworks, reviewing & building salary ranges, and aligning tools and processes.
Translate strategy into clear operational practices that integrate into day-to-day People and Finance workflows.
Provide guidance to People Partners and managers on compensation principles and application.
__Benchmarking & Market Insights__
Manage participation in salary survey submissions and maintain market data libraries.
Conduct benchmarking analyses and provide compensation recommendations grounded in data and market trends.
__Staff Cost Management & Budgeting__
Review and validate compensation-related approvals for hires, promotions, and adjustments, ensuring alignment with budget requirements.
Partner closely with Finance to monitor staff costs and headcount plans.
Oversee the preparation & build of templates and files for the 2027 staff budgeting cycle, including detailed Total Cost to Company (TCTC) calculations across multiple regions and employment structures. *(2027 budgeting process will extend beyond contract)*
__Additional Responsibilities__
Assist the Senior Systems & Data Analyst to leverage our HRIS to enable accurate compensation data, reporting, and workflows.
Provide support for ad-hoc HR data reporting and insights, if needed.
Requirements
**Qualifications and experience:**
Demonstrated experience working on hands-on compensation projects, including designing or revamping compensation structures or strategies.
Experience partnering with Finance on budgeting, forecasting, and cost management.
Strong Excel skills and the ability to manage complex data sets while ensuring high accuracy.
Exposure to multi-location compensation structures or global reward operations.
Experience participating in or managing salary survey submissions.
Experience working with an HRIS, ideal but not required.
**Skills, knowledge and abilities:**
Highly organised and able to manage multiple deadlines during peak annual cycles.
Comfortable operating independently with sound judgment.
Clear communicator able to translate data and strategy into practical guidance for stakeholders.
Pragmatic problem-solver with a continuous improvement mindset.
